Efficacy of colonoscopy after an episode of acute diverticulitis and risk of colorectal cancer

BACKGROUND: Diverticular disease of the colon has a high global prevalence. The guidelines suggest performing a colonoscopy 4-6 weeks after the acute episode to exclude colorectal cancer (CRC).
